Bitcoin: The Digital Gold
Bitcoin has often been referred to as “digital gold,” and for good reason. Its scarcity and decentralized nature make it an attractive hedge against inflation and economic uncertainty. As traditional markets face volatility, many investors are turning to Bitcoin as a safe haven, further driving demand.
The price of Bitcoin is currently down more than 40% from its all-time high, with the last major bitcoin hit marking a significant peak before the recent decline. Notably, Bitcoin has never had back-to-back losing years from 2012 to 2025, delivering triple-digit returns in seven of those years.
The narrative around Bitcoin as a store of value is gaining traction, especially as precious metals prices fluctuate. Bitcoin’s value proposition is often described as scarcity, despite its weak correlation with gold—correlations have never exceeded +0.41 on a rolling 12-month basis. Since 2024, Bitcoin's correlation with gold has dropped to around zero, and the asset has displayed a negative correlation with the U.S. dollar, sometimes as strong as -0.4. Analysts’ Predictions for 2026
Analysts are divided on the future of crypto prices, with some predicting a significant rally while others remain cautious. Many believe that the combination of institutional adoption, regulatory clarity, and technological advancements will create a favorable environment for price appreciation.
When it comes to Bitcoin price predictions for 2026, the forecasts vary widely. Analysts at Standard Chartered predict Bitcoin will reach $150,000 by year-end 2026, while the Finder poll of crypto analysts found an average price forecast of $138,300 for the same period. Nexo's research team expects Bitcoin could reach between $150,000 and $200,000 by year-end, and Youwei Yang, chief economist at Bit Mining, forecasts a trading range between $75,000 and $225,000 in 2026. Overall, Bitcoin's price predictions for 2026 range from $75,000 to as high as $250,000, contingent on macroeconomic conditions and regulatory clarity.
Prediction markets also provide insight into market sentiment. For example, traders on Polymarket give Bitcoin a 12% chance of hitting $150,000 by the end of the year, and other prediction markets suggest there is basically an 11% chance for Bitcoin to reach that target by the end of 2026. At the same time, traders currently believe there is a significant chance that Bitcoin could fall below $70,000.
